today i saw a couple of films in a theater...one of them was 'sympathy for lady vengeance' the third and final film of a trilogy of films with revenge being the theme.....i was disappointed with this film..it was disjointed...it was hard to follow...perhaps it was the translation of korean language to english subtitles?...there was way too much voiceover and background information which should have been left out....i found it to be distracting.....by far this was the weakest and least effective film of the three films in the series......imo 'oldboy' is the best of all of them.......
